“Florida Weddings and Special Events, Inc. the parent company of Florida Weddings and Special Events Magazine has earned it’s rank on the Web. The main corporation and web portal were founded in 2002, launching the bilingual bridal and quince print version in 2006. The print magazine is fully uploaded to the World Wide Web, and therefore can now be called a full regional Florida wedding and quince publication; extending and maximizing their readership to include everyone surfing the Internet.

Their main portal, www.FloridaWeddingsandSpecialEvents.com, is easily found when you search the Internet as one of the main and most visible quinceañera and bridal web sites of Florida.

The officers of the company are Isabel and Carlos Albuerne. Isabel is better known as the “The Event Lady” and has been in the wedding and quince industry as a coordinator for over 20 years. With a focus now in publishing, this Hispanic origin couple is the pioneer publisher in SW Florida, with the first bilingual bridal and quince publication in their area.

This English and Spanish format, full color, glossy, consumer size publication has found a niche in the special event industry, focusing and addressing the needs of planning a wedding reception or a sweet fifteen/sixteen party in the diverse cultural market of the State of Florida.

As a new publication they offer a circulation of 40,000 a year and distribute at over 300 key locations in Collier, Lee and Charlotte Counties. These locations include a weekly complimentary distribution system at all the local Blockbuster Video Stores in the above mentioned Florida counties. These distribution points are specifically targeted to the special event industry. The magazine is handed out complimentary as well at bridal and quince shows in the SW Florida area. The goal of the publisher is to extend further into SW Florida and reach 100,000 by the end of 2008.

Subscription is also available thru their web site to receive the magazine by US Postal Mail for out-of-state quince girls or Florida destination brides. This magazine offers quince and bridal related news and trends at a local level; but now, thanks to the magnitude of the Internet, it can reach all of Florida on a regional level as well.
